Meeting notes — Pagerloom dedup review. We walked through the new alert deduplicator's fingerprint window, confirming that the 90-second bucket correctly collapses repeated disk-pressure alerts without masking distinct hosts. Reviewer should verify the hash excludes timestamps. One open question on tombstone expiry remains. The change awaits sign-off from the on-call lead.

account owner for bawip-tahag: Raleth Quenok

Quarterly Planning Note — Commission Scheme Revision

Following the Q2 review, management proposes revising the sales-commission scheme for all Hartwyn Instruments territories. The new structure replaces flat-rate payouts with a tiered model weighted toward multi-year contracts, capping accelerators at 140 percent of base. Modelling by the Pellworth office suggests a neutral cost impact in year one and modest savings thereafter. Full tables are appended for board scrutiny. The confidential rationale follows below.

internal memo for kawip-hadug: Headcount on the Wenwyn team goes from 7 to 140 by the end of January. Gross margin on Wenwyn came in at 20 percent against a plan of 15 percent.

## Image Slimming: Limits and Quotas

The Pruneline slimmer strips debug symbols, docs, and locale data from release images before they land in the Vexhall registry. Slimming runs are capped per release train; exceeding the layer-count or size ceilings fails the pipeline rather than shipping a bloated image. Release managers should confirm caps before cutting a train. The current tuning constants are listed below.

tuning constants:
QUOTAS = {
    "druwyn": 5,
    "holix": 5,
    "zorath": 5,
    "holwyn": 10,
}

Escalation, consent banner rollout: if Bannerette starts eating more than 2% of page loads or legal flags copy issues, pause the Flagwick rollout flag yourself — don't wait for sign-off. Ping the privacy channel, then the rollout captain. If nobody bites within 30 minutes, it's officially an incident. Escalations outside business hours go straight to the on-call inbox.

alerts address for yajof-kahog: eliax@qirvanlabs.corp